Reinstall pch-a110 HDD and firmware
Hi guys,
Yesterday I had a problem when trying load the files from the internal hdd, it just got stuck in loading files proceses (blue screen at the beginning, when you conect pch after passing files using usb slave from a pc). But when I conect the pch a110 to the pc it works an load fine. The internal hdd is a WD 500gib, and had like 150 gigs free. I deleted most of the files and finally make it work but the .srt files didnt load at the beginning, after alot of work I made them run. So I guess the problem is with the internal HDD, so my question is how i can reformat the internal disk, and also the firemware version of my pch110, I try the reset to factory setting in mantaince options but it just modify the setting for video (etc) it didnt modify to a oldest firmware version at all. (I am really noob to this stuff but i guess that firmware version are store apart from the files of the internal disk) Well I hope I explain well my problem, english is my 2 lenguage (dispite i dont speak well my primmary lenguage also xd) (PD: I have all files backup already so thats why I want to reformat all to make it work fine again) |

RE: Reinstall pch-a110 HDD and firmware
Alright, 1st. if I'd be you, I will check the HDD integrity. You're saying that the HDD is a WD.
Then you should run "Data Lifeguard Diagnostic" which is a SW from WD, check the link above: Code: http://support.wdc.com/product/download.asp?level1=6&lang=enYou could also try other 3rd. party software like: SpinRite HDD Regenerator According to the description of the problems, sound like the HDD is having problems, or the filesystem got damaged. For reinstalling NMT applications, check the following link, and follow those steps: Code: http://www.networkedmediatank.com/wiki/index.php/Reinstalling_NMT_AppsBTW... have you already checked, if your HDD is between those compatibility tested if not check that here:Code: http://www.networkedmediatank.com/wiki/index.php/HDD_Compatibility_A-100/A-110Gooo luck!
